Florence Lee letter to her sweetheart Captain James A. Sayles, February 5 1864
Created Date | 1864 |
Description | A young woman's letter to her sweetheart, recounting a visit to his mother in Moline as well as observations on recent social events in their hometown. Written from Rock Island, Illinois. |
